修改在文章列表页没有缩略图时不显示图片,有则显示

时间:2015-05-03

dede5.5和5.3的文章列表页如果你没有加上一个缩略图,会显示一个小小的图片显示无缩略图,影响了美观和网站的空间。
如果要做到没有缩略图的不显示图片,有的则显示缩略图。即有的显示,无的不显示,可以这样修改:

进入list_article.htm找到以下代码:

[field:array runphp='yes']@me = (empty(@me['litpic']) ? "" : "<a href='{@me['arcurl']}' class='preview'><img src='{@me['litpic']}'/></a>"); [/field:array]

换成以下代码:

[field:array runphp='yes']@me = (strpos(@me['litpic'],'defaultpic') ? "" : "<a href='{@me['arcurl']}' class='preview'><img src='{@me['litpic']}'/></a>"); [/field:array]

然后重新生成一下,即可达到效果。

上一条:DEDE限制某个字段只有会员才能浏览 下一条:Dedecms的自定义模型无法投稿的解决

相关文章

最新文章